Execution Plan

  1. Narrow the offer to 1–2 high-demand niches in Sofia (e.g., exam prep or language programs) and align packages to those needs
  2. Build an acquisition funnel with local SEO and partnerships (schools, parent groups) to target steady weekly enrollment rather than one-off sessions
  3. Implement pricing and capacity controls: set minimum class sizes, adjust tutor schedules to demand, and track contribution margin per cohort
  4. Reduce fixed costs by using part-time tutors, shorter leases or off-peak room rentals, and standardized lesson plans to improve utilization
  5. Run a 60-day enrollment and conversion test (lead-to-trial, trial-to-paid) with daily targets and revise ads/offer if targets miss
